Vitamin Deficiencies: Are They Impacting Your Mood?
Feeling sad lately? It's easy to overlook persistent low spirits as just life's challenges , but a deficiency of certain vitamins could actually be playing a significant role. Research suggest that low levels of vitamin D, B12, folate, and iron can all contribute to changes in mood . While it's best to consult with a doctor to identify any underlying medical conditions , ensuring you're getting adequate of these essential nutrients through diet or prescribed medication might be a straightforward step towards boosting your overall emotional state.

Fueling Your Mind: Nutrition Strategies for Mental Health
Your mind’s operation is deeply affected by what you consume. Prioritizing a healthy diet can be a powerful approach for enhancing emotional well-being. Think about incorporating foods rich in omega-3 fatty acids, minerals, and protective compounds, such as fatty fish, kale, berries, and nuts. Reducing junk food, refined sugars, and chemicals can also benefit your mental clarity and alleviate symptoms of anxiety. Ultimately, fueling your body properly is a vital step toward good emotional stability.
